Manchester United manager Jose Mourinho is ready to take a risk and wait until the transfer window deadline to sign Southampton defender Jose Fonte according to the Express.

Per the source, Mourinho has identified the Portuguese international defender as his top transfer priority in what would be his fifth signing of the suffer.

Mourinho is even reported to be prepared to enter a stand-off with the board over his pursuit of the experienced defender.

The Red Devils have already spent £145m on Paul Pogba, Zlatan Ibrahimovic, Henrikh Mkhitaryan and Eric Bailly this summer.

The Express also have reported that Southampton are desperate to keep Fonte at the club and are willing to offer a two-year contract extension.

The Euro 2016 winner currently has just one year left on his contract and despite being offered a new deal, he has yet to agree on personal terms which in turn could pave the way for a cut-price move to Old Trafford.
